Cereal with wic9/11/2023 When kids get closer to the teen years, from 9 to 13, they need around 8 milligrams every day. Children up to 4 years of age need 7 milligrams of iron every day and kids from 4 to 8 years of age need 10 milligrams.From 7 to 12 months of age, infants need 11 milligrams each day of iron.If the infant is not being breastfed they should be on a formula that is iron fortified. When they are around 4 to 6 months old they will begin consuming iron fortified cereal. When an infant is breastfeeding, he or she will get their iron from their mom.When it comes to how much iron children need, it is different at every age. Women who are pregnant need up to 27 milligrams each day to account for their development and help them keep up the rapid growth of their baby. Women who are under the age of 50 need around 18 milligrams each day in order to make up for the loss of iron they experience through their menstrual cycles. Postmenopausal women and healthy men need about 8 milligrams of iron each day. Making sure you add iron fortified cereal to your regular diet is an easy way to remedy this. Without the right amount of iron you can become anemic or deficient in iron. Our circulation and red blood cell formulation depends on iron to function properly. Our blood is made up of iron and proteins called globins. You may hear about so many vitamins and minerals that we need to include in our diets but iron is an important one.
